I'd advise always staying away from automatic link exchanges. There aren't quick ways to the top of the SERPs, but there are some pretty quick ways to wake up one morning and find yourself out of the SERPs completely. Automated link exchanges can help you get to the bottom fast.

You can't really control who links to you and for the most part links from other sites to yours won't hurt regardless of where those links are from. It's mostly going to be the links to other sites that you have on your site that will get you in toruble. It's when you link back to a bad neighborhood that Google will decide you're involving yourself in something solely for the purpose of manipulating rankings.
Most of the bad links to your site will just be ignored so while they may not hurt they're probably not going to help either.

Vigor it's true you don't always have control over who links to you, but in this case the automatic software is setting up link exchanges so you would also be linking out to those other sites.
It's also true that if your overall link profile is not very strong then you can be affected by having a lot of spammy sites linking to you. The best defense is to get more of the good kinds of links from trusted sources related to your site.
